What is the motivation for success for every day

We have all heard this phrase many times: Movement is life. I don't think anyone is going to argue with her. So, in Latin, the movement is translated as motus In other words, motivation. It turns out that motivation is life.

But it's true! Everyone who achieves something in life is initially very motivated. Many examples can be seen in films. Yes, movies are fairy tales for adults, but you can draw important conclusions from each story. Take, for example, the well-known movie Rocky. would have achieved main character your goal without motivation? Of course not, every day he went to his dream, and without motivation he would not have coped with the accompanying obstacles.

Don't like the movie example? The story of the author and actor of the main character of the film is also interesting. Sylvester Stallone was already about thirty years old when, previously unknown to anyone, he wrote the script for the film and stormed film studios with it. His condition was that he play the lead character. And how to survive all the numerous failures in such a situation without motivation for success? As a result, Sylvester achieved his goal, and today the whole world knows about him.

Just like that, everything goes only in such rare exceptions that they are not even worth considering.

How motivation works

In order for motivation to work, the following conditions must be met:

  1. Achievable Goal - You need to know exactly what you want to achieve and imagine how you can do it.
  2. Reward - you need to understand what exactly you will receive as a result of achieving the goal and want it.
  3. Attached actions - they should be at least enough.
  4. A moment of urgency - you definitely need to limit yourself in time, because it can easily nullify all efforts.

I'll give you a personal example. Once in my student years, I discovered the world of electronic music and dreamed of becoming a DJ. This is a pretty commonplace dream among club culture, and there are many reasons why it will not come true and how difficult it is to achieve. But there was a desire. For several years I just thought about it without doing anything.

Then I decided to take action. I found a place to organize a party and agreed on a date for it. I called the DJs I knew to perform and told everyone that I would also perform at this event. I deliberately created such conditions for myself that failure was not even considered. I had motivation, I knew what to do and why, what I would get in the end and the deadlines in which I had to cope. In the end, everything turned out great, and this moment will forever remain my small victory. And the more such victories each of us has, the easier it is to embody more complicated plans.
